You + Scenic America = Legal Precedent?
Have you or someone you know been affected by a digital billboard visible from your home? Ever been in a car accident due to the distraction of a digital billboard on the highway? If so, please contact Kate DeAngelis at (deangelis at scenic dot org). Scenic America is looking for a defendant they can assist. Scenic promises that the commitment will be minimal – in fact her words were “they do not need to do anything or pay any money.” The permit for the billboard must have been issued after October 1, 2007.
Scenic America does great work so please contact Kate if you can help!
